GAME OF THE YEAR 2007: SUPER MARIO GALAXY

I can't believe I'm giving this award to this game. I mean... a childish, Wii-exclusive platformer? Being my Game of the Year? I must have lost my marbles. But Super Mario Galaxy is the only game that perfects all of the criteria I listed below. I mean, the game consistently blew me away. The graphics are absolutely perfect -- both artistically AND technically. The music is just phenomenal. The game is entirely innovative, yet combines the right amount of old and new. The cinematography is spectacular, the level designs are the best i've seen in a platformer... the list just goes on. When a game released in a genre that i don't like manages to captivate me, i give it special praise (much like Oblivion). But when it manages to captivate me for hours, and end up being the best game released all year, i give it love.

There's not much to say that hasn't already been said. Resident Evil 4: Wii Edition, The Orange Box, and Mass Effect were all outstandingly amazing games, but Super Mario Galaxy rises above them in more ways than one. It's the game that proves you don't need to use all the polygons in the world to look amazing, that you don't need to spend half your budget on voice actors, and that you can't judge a book by its cover. It looks childish, it looks crazy, but by God is it fun. In a year full of the most high-quality gaming releases, Super Mario Galaxy stands out as the best game released all year, and a game that can only make one wonder how Nintendo can significantly improve on it.

It's a game you should buy a Wii to play. A game you should place next to you in your coffin.
